The Mongolian traditional house, called “Ger” is a typical accommodation of Mongolian nomads and has reflected representative artistic and regional styles of the country. It is also made from natural resources and is a comfortable dwelling in which to live. It has a architectural design that includes a half sphere structural form and a round floor. The Ger has several characteristics including good illumination, heating and air circulation, it can be easily disassembled, transported and assembled and also features few other structural components to protect against the wind and earthquakes. This study is aimed at building a database for relevant studies by analyzing the heating and air circulation systems of Ger and further proposing the technology that can apply to residential buildings by a SWOT (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ities and Threats) analysis.
